Thanks to this month’s Weekend Breakfast Blogging theme of Summer Fruits, I realized how easy and simple it is to make a healthy breakfast. This crunchy bowl was yummy and delicious and took just minutes to assemble.
Ingredients
- 2 cups granola
- 1 cup sliced strawberries
- 1/2 cup sliced bananas
- 2 cups plain fat free yogurt
- 2 tbsp honey
- 1/4 cup chopped walnuts
- 2 tbsp sliced almonds
- 2 tbsp seedless raisins
Method
This is a slightly complicated process, follow the instructions carefully! Mix yogurt and honey in a bowl, add the rest of the ingredients and mix well. Hope it wasn’t too hard to follow.
